Assessing Heat Resistance of Ceramic Items

Ceramic isn’t a single material; it’s a family that ranges from stoneware to porcelain, each with distinct thermal properties. Stoneware, fired at high temperatures (1,200–1,300 °F), typically withstands oven heat up to 400–450 °F. Porcelain, fired at even higher temperatures (2,200 °F), can often handle 500 °F or more. Clayware or earthenware, on the other hand, may crack under sudden temperature changes.

When you look at a dish, consider its thickness, glaze, and whether it’s labeled “oven‑safe.” A thick, dense piece with a smooth glaze usually indicates high firing temperatures and better heat tolerance. Thin, fragile items—especially those with decorative paint—are more likely to fail.

Using the Oven with Confidence: Once you’ve identified a ceramic item as oven‑safe, use it in a conventional oven set between 350–400 °F. Avoid rapid temperature changes: let the oven preheat before placing the dish, and never slam a hot ceramic onto a cold surface. These practices keep thermal shock at bay and extend the life of your cookware.

What Happens When You Use Non‑Oven‑Safe Ceramic?

Using a non‑oven‑safe ceramic in a high‑heat environment can lead to several problems:

1. Thermal Shock: Rapid temperature change forces the ceramic to expand and contract unevenly, causing cracks or even shattering.

2. Glaze Failure: Heat can loosen or peel the glaze, leaving the underlying ceramic exposed to food and moisture, which can lead to staining or bacterial growth.

3. Safety Hazards: A cracked ceramic can release sharp shards into food, posing a choking or injury risk.

4. Cost: Replacing a cracked dish or repairing a broken decorative item can be expensive, especially if the piece is heirloom or custom.

If you accidentally use a non‑oven‑safe piece, inspect it immediately. If cracks appear, discard or repair it; never use it again in the oven.

Ceramic Baking Dishes: From Roasts to Casseroles

Ceramic baking dishes are the heart of many family recipes. Stoneware and porcelain bakeware are prized for even heat distribution and their ability to hold high temperatures. A 12‑inch stoneware baking dish, for instance, can comfortably handle 450 °F for a roast.

When using ceramic bakeware, always preheat the dish with the oven. This prevents sudden temperature changes that could cause cracks. If you need to add a sauce or liquid, pour it in slowly to avoid thermal shock.

How to Properly Care for Oven‑Safe Ceramics: Maintenance Tips

Once you’ve identified an oven‑safe ceramic, keep it in good shape with these habits:

1. Avoid abrupt temperature changes. Let the dish cool gradually after removing it from the oven.

2. Use silicone or parchment paper to protect the glaze from direct flame or high‑heat surfaces.

3. Clean with mild, non‑abrasive cleaners. Harsh scouring pads can scratch the glaze and reduce heat tolerance.

4. Store with a soft cloth or paper towel between pieces to prevent scratches.

Following these steps extends the life of your ceramics and keeps them safe for future cooking adventures.
